Purple sauce

Purple sauce is a type of sauce with a purple color, often used in culinary applications. It can be made from various ingredients, such as purple carrots or purple sweet potatoes, which naturally give the sauce its color. Purple sauces are used in both savory and sweet dishes, and can range from a light purple hue to a deep, rich purple.

Purple analogous colors

Analogous colors to purple are hues that are next to purple on the color wheel, such as violet, plum, and deep pink. These colors share a common color base and are used to create harmonious color schemes.
